This shocking statistic is a damning indictment of the Blueco ownership, who have spent over £1.37 BILLION on new players since taking over in May 2022.

Before dropping the bombshell, Shearer pointed out that Everton covered a total of 111.9km compared to ‘s 105.8km.

He said: “A staggering stat we found is every Premier League game this season, Chelsea have been outrun by the opposition.

“In every single game, home and away, Chelsea have played, the opposition have outrun them. What does that tell you?”

Chelsea have the lowest average squad age in the league at 23.4 years, more than four years fewer than (27.7 years) who have the oldest squad.

Chapman said: “There’s a five-year average difference (starting 11) between Everton (29y, 25d) and Chelsea (24y 208d).

“You look at Chelsea and think they could do with a couple of 30-year-olds, don’t you?”

Rooney agreed, adding: “They’ve got a lot of young players and they are very inexperienced. The team does change quite a bit as well.

“I don’t think they’re getting the togetherness on the pitch so the more you change the young players, they don’t get a run of games and they don’t compete.”
